# Runbook: Broker Upgrade — Pellwick Queue

Upgrade nodes one at a time, oldest version first. Drain consumers, snapshot the journal, then apply the package. Verify replication lag is zero before moving on. Never upgrade two nodes in the same availability group simultaneously. Rollback means restoring the snapshot, not downgrading in place. Before starting, confirm the cluster matches the expected baseline values listed below.

deployment values, kajep-kageg:
[praix]
host = praix.paliqcorp.corp
user = praix_svc
database = praix_prod

Handover — Velmora Trade Fair pop-up, Hall C

Tomas, the booth office stays staffed overnight since the demo rigs for the Quellix launch can't be left unattended. The kettle trips the fuse if run with the heater, so alternate them. Fair security does rounds at 01:00 and 04:00; show them the exhibitor list in the drawer. For the rear office door, use the pass below.

turnstile pass: bdg-QZV-3

**Capacity note: idempotency key storage.** Retried payments on Ledgewick write one idempotency key per attempt, and the key table grows faster than the ledger itself during gateway flaps. We size the store around peak retry storms, not steady state, so don't raise retention without checking disk headroom first. Current sizing and expiry constants are listed here.

limits module of fajog-tawig:
RATE_LIMITS = {
    "druwyn": 2,
    "quenael": 10,
    "wenix": 2,
    "druael": 2,
}

Heads up, support team: we've changed several rendering defaults in the Inkmill pipeline. Raw HTML passthrough is now disabled by default, smart quotes are on, and the maximum document size for synchronous rendering dropped from 5 MB to 2 MB — larger documents queue for async rendering instead. Customers on older defaults may notice quote styling changes or embedded HTML showing as plain text; point them to the opt-out setting. For reference when handling tickets, the new defaults are listed below.

deployment values, yadug-bawif:
[framir]
team = pelox
access_code = ac_a38ab2
owner = tamion.julael
host = framir.tolvaqlabs.test
port = 11211
peer = tammir.zemvargrid.local
salt = 2215ef03
pin = 1541